  4. First match. You did a DP, looked like you were trying to bait something and she didn't act, but it was a very gutsy move, not bad but be wary. Dust combos are a common place to burst as well, it was early in the match so the threat was low, but I get many burst baits by dust, and you were in the corner so if the opponent reads that about you it could be very deadly. My initial impression is you are not very familiar with the Elphelt matchup, so you respect a lot, which is good! Better than trying to disrespect back. Elph is very scary in the corner, she has many options, but if she's doing jab pressure get out of there. At around 8:25 you used a double RC in the combo, I'll assume there was some panic in this regard? You had meterless combo options so I suppose you wanted to go for a possibly cleaner combo ender. Going into round 2 you got caught by dust now fairly frequently, so it sends the message to the Elph that you respect her pressure and may possibly be slow to adapt, which means the player is likely to continue to attempt at tripping you up with it more. Sin's buttons are slow so it's a smart gamble on her part, but it's all about the message it sends. Your sense of meter converting is good, though it seems like you do not at times finish the combos. Feels like you want to keep your meater topped off, which is great in general but it costs you a lot of damage in some cases of upwards 50-100, and it cost the second round here unfortunately. Third round, it seems you have now adapted to her disrespect dust strategy which is really great. But then she does it again next chance she gets =|. You knocked her back and did a running 6H in I'm guessing a meaty attempt into a large damage conversion, but 6H is imo too risky to use in such a way, since it shifts your body very close to the opponent before it becomes active and as such is in many cases a free reversal grab or neutral grab if the opponent is diligent.Then of course not utilizing the burst. Since she disrespects it would have been good to use on wakeup which would give you full meter and the neutral back. She did have meter to RC so I understand the risk but at this point the player has shown themselves not to be behaving in that regard. If you did burst and she baited it, atleast then you had the knowledge going into the next match if the player makes use of that. I think ultimately not blocking the dusts resulted in the match loss, since overall you're a good player but I think you just respected your opponent too much and perhaps may be leery of the matchup. Her dust is -8, so if you IB it that's a huge punish in your favour. Match 2 of set 1. At around 11:00, you have the momentum, but you use your meter for literally no reason ><. You RRC'd the Elk Hunt from Beak Driver into 3K, and the issue with that is your opponent was already blocking and 236H is a mid which commonly gets cancelled into the 236K low, so unless she scouts an overhead which Sin is not good at, or a risky throw, she had no real threat for that RRC unless she was being very reversal happy which Elphelt cannot play. The Bull Bash YRC was a nice attempt, it would probably catch an average player pretty well, but the freeze from the YRC is enough time for a human to react to, and again with no overhead option she is safe to go back to brainlessly blocking low. By this point the Elph recognizes that you use a basic special string, so she can easily block it and just wait for you to burn meater. The most common Sin matchup tactic is block until me(a)ter is gone and then get at him, so as Sin users we must be /very/ creative in pressure (It's the struggle). Overall though you definitely seemed to get more of a bearing this match, perhaps a bit of a warm up and possibly beginning to see the opponent's traits more. Good stuff. Match 3 of set 1. It seems like off CH's your confirms are lacking, so I guess either start adding the followups to your game, or if you do have them then it's a situational awareness thing, not the end of the world. The meaty DP is an interesting choice, the YRC mixup after was very nice. I like the Beak Driver chip out attempt, smart play but the Elphelt was aware, still great job. By this point your confidence looks much better and the Elphelt was ultimately sloppy, not trying to respect the neutral but going for a cheap win.
